  • Imagine having a choice in an election.

    US vote rules were updated last time in 1965, here rules change before each election, usually 3-4 month prior.

    I noticed recently that they stopped publishing 23:59 laws. You know laws which are published on the official website one minute before midnight, and they are valid from the next day. I dont know why they stopped, maybe they did this because it was during a state of emergency?

    Migration emergency is still ongoing since 2015, last time they extended until 2024 sept. We had covid emergency and inflation emergency as well. I think the "there is a war in a neighboring country" emergency is still ongoing. I don't know because the "WAR" billboard ads were replaced with "join the army" and "Orbán is PEACE" ads, I dont know if they are related to this

    Lol they have debates there, in television. We had debates, last time it was in 2006.

    I'm looking forward to the 2026 elections, its possible that something will change, lol

    Before the EU election each opposition party got 10 minutes to speak in the state television. This was an improvement from the 2022 election, they got only 5 minutes each that time. They cannot get any other screentime between elections.

    Katalin Novák (president of Hungary) has resigned
    telex.hu Katalin Novák has resigned

    She is the second Hungarian head of state to resign over a scandal since Fidesz began governing in 2010. Former justice minister Judit Varga, who countersigned the presidential pardon granted by Novák, has also resigned from all her duties.

    Hungary 2024: Soviet tractor overtakes Czechslovak train

    Background: there is a 20kph speedlimit for trains on this section because of the state of the rails. The max speed of an MTZ tractor is 30-35 kph
